Work experience is not imp. for the FIIB PGDM program. Newly graduated students can apply for the programme. However, students with 1–3 years of working experience can receive additional weightage, which consequently improves their chances of the PGDM selection process.
Applicants must upload:
- At the time of completing the online application for PGDM courses, there are several important documents that students need to be attached.
- HSC and SSC marksheets
- Graduation marksheet
- Proof of entrance exam results
- Government-issued ID proof
- Updated resume
- 1 passport-sized photograph, etc.
These all doc. can be uplaoded on online admission portal of FIIB Delhi.
The end date for applying into PGDM course at FIIB Delhi has been announced with the track of the cycles of admissions, which are held in diff. months. The deadlines are as follows:
● Cycle 1 Deadline: 28 November
● Cycle 2 Deadline: 15 January
● Cycle 3 Deadline: 11 March
Program Starting: 12 June for the new AY academic years).
FIIB CAT Cutoff 2025 was released for admission to the MBA/PGDM courses. According to the FIIB PGDM Cutoff 2025, students belonging to the General category under the All India quota needed to secure at least 60 percentile for admission at FIIB. The institute also accepts other MBA entrance exams, like GMAT, XAT, CMAT, MAT, and ATMA, with a minimum percentile of 60.
The packages accepted by PGDM students during FIIB Delhi placements 2025 is mentioned below:
Particulars | Placement Statistics 2025 |
|---|---|
Highest package | INR 25 LPA |
Average package | INR 8.5 LPA |
Top 20% package | INR 12 LPA |
Top 30% package | INR 9.5 LPA |
Top 40% package | INR 8.8 LPA |
